img {border: 0; margin: auto}
body {font-family: arial, helvica, sans-serif; margin: 0 ; background: #91a9c3}
#container {
  position: relative;
  width: 58.5em;
  margin: auto;
}
#unam, #siav {position: absolute; background: #1e3148; z-index: 2; top: 0}
#unam {left: 0}
#siav {right: 0}
#header p {
  position: absolute;
  top: 0;
  left: 0;
  color: #e88610;
  background: #1e3148;
  height: 6em;
  width: 46em;
  padding: 1.75em 0 1.75em 11em;
  margin: 0;
  line-height: 1.5;
  z-index: 1;
}
#hl1 {font-size: 1.25em}
#hl2 {text-transform: uppercase; font-size: 1.5em; font-weight: bold}
#hl3 {font-size: 1.5em}
#navigation {
  position: absolute;
  top: 12.75em;
  left: 0;
  z-index: 4;
  color: #e88610;
  font-size: 0.75em;
  padding: 2em 0em 0em 1em;
  background: #1e3148;
  width: 9em;
}
#navigation ul {
  list-style: none inside;
  padding: 0;
  margin: 0;
}
#navigation ul a {
  text-decoration: none;
  text-transform: uppercase;
  display: block;
  color: #fecf2d;
  margin: 0.75em 0;
  background: #1e3148;
}
#inv td{
  padding:20px;
  width: 450px;
}
#inv tr{
  bgcolor: white;
}

/*#navigation a:hover {background: #4b8c5b}*/
#content  {
  position: absolute;
  top: 9.5em;
  left: 0;
  z-index: 3;
  text-align: justify;
  border-left: 9em solid #1e3148;
  padding: 3em;
}



#content h1{font-size: 1.5em; font-weight: normal; color: #031634}
#content h2{font-size: 1.35em; font-weight: normal}
#content h3{font-size: 1.2em; font-weight: normal}
#content a:link {color: #033649}
#content a:visited {color: #fecf2d}
#content th,td,tr {border: 1px solid #106b21}
#content td {text-align: left}
#content th {text-align: center; background: #1e3148}
#content dt {line-height: 2; clear: left}
#content dd {padding: 0; margin: 0}
#content dd ul {list-style: inside; text-align: left}
#content td ul {list-style: inside; padding: 0; margin: 0}
#content img {float: left}

.content p {
align-text: justify; color: #034569
}

#data {clear: left}
#data ul {list-style: none; padding: 0; margin: 0}
.invite {text-align: center; font-weight: bold}
.titles {color: #0000f0; font-weight: bold; font-size: small; background:#F5F5DC }
.titles2 {color: #0000f0; font-weight: bold; font-size: small; background:#F0F8FF }
.institute {color: #505050}
.institucion {text-align: center; font-weight: bold; display: block}
.instituteref {font-size: 1.35em; text-decoration: none; text-align: left}
.high1 {background: #ff6}
.high2 {background: #ff3}
.high3 {color: #0000f0; font-weight: bold}
.holiday {background:#476C47; font-size: 1.5em; display: block; font-weight: bold; color: #FFFFFF; line-height: 2; text-align: center}
.camsede {background: #afa; font-size: 1.25em; display: block; text-align: center}
.cent {text-align: center; display: block; font-weight: bold}
.dtb {font-weight: bold}
.colores1 {background:#F5F5DC}
.colores2 {background:#F0F8FF}

